What is the sad story behind Lilo and Stitch?

After losing both parents in a car accident, Lilo is left in the care of her older sister Nani. Chris Sanders' and Dean DeBlois' animated film Lilo and Stitch unravels the precarious nature of trauma in the lives of two young sisters, forced to grow up faster than most.

Who bullied Lilo?

Mertle takes great pleasure in putting down, insulting, bullying and making fun of Lilo. Mertle also tends not to take responsibility for her actions; she blamed Lilo for beating her up in hula class, even though she was being cruel to Lilo, which provoked her into beating her up in the first place.

What is Lilo's full name?

Lilo Pelekai (first name pronounced /ˈliːloʊ]/ LEE-lo, last name Peh-leh-kai) is one of the two characters of the Disney animated movie Lilo & Stitch, its sequels, and the animated series. Lilo (literally, "lost" in Hawaiian, and also in Mandarin).

What does Lilo call her doll?

Scrump is Lilo's homemade rag doll. Lilo made Scrump herself and often has to give her "surgery" after she gets torn. She made her debut in Lilo & Stitch and was also seen throughout the franchise.

How old is Lilo now?

Lilo Pelekai: Lilo in the original concept story was five years old, but in the original film she is six. This is best evidenced by the ending montage in the original film where she and the 'ohana celebrate her seventh birthday, as evidenced by the candles on the birthday cake that Stitch baked for her.

Does Lilo love Nani?

Despite their sometimes rocky relationship, Nani and Lilo care deeply for each other, and this strong bond is shown continuously throughout the film. Through her sister and the loss of their folks, Nani is shown to have a motherly side, and often makes decisions based on Lilo's best interest, alone.

Who is Stitch's girlfriend?

Angel, also known as Experiment 624, is a major character in the Lilo & Stitch franchise. She is an illegal genetic experiment created by Jumba Jookiba, Stitch's love interest/mate (or "boojiboo", as they call each other), and female counterpart.

Is Lilo religious?

spiritual content: Lilo kneels at her bedside to pray for a friend, and asks God to send a nice angel. Her theology is a mixed bag, however, as she also uses a book entitled “Practical Voodoo” to take revenge on kids who teased her.
